Chapter 17 - LactatED: A stat consult on optimizing lactation in the ED
01 Apr 2023
Possibly the first ever podcast dedicated to optimizing the experience of lactating persons in the ED, Alex and Venk sit down with Dr. Sarah Dodd, assistant professor of anesthesiology at Mayo Clinic and passionate champion for optimizing the care of lactating persons throughout healthcare. Lengthy ED visits have the potential to begin a cascade that hastens the end of milk production, and is a significant source of stress for lactating persons and families. We have an opportunity to do better. Learn how to navigate medications, procedural sedation, long ED length-of-stay and more!
